Output ef660a29d8c81bc872a88938b621dfff524e8bcfccfa65058a50224cb4879d71:2

value
58883780
script pubkey
OP_0 OP_PUSHBYTES_20 92f80fe43711971654fb6c9f5fba9a4c4c1e8fd2
address
bc1qjtuqlephzxt3v48mdj04lw56f3xpar7jpz2kn5
transaction
ef660a29d8c81bc872a88938b621dfff524e8bcfccfa65058a50224cb4879d71
spent
true